The transcript discusses the surprising results of the German election, highlighting the weak performance of the CDU and the rise of smaller parties like the Afd and Liberals. It explores the implications for Chancellor Merkel and the potential formation of a Jamaica coalition. The conversation also touches on the priorities of the German electorate, the economic context, and the challenges facing the future government, including the need for economic reforms and addressing voter dissatisfaction.
